#60bb4e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#60bb4e is composed of 37.6% red, 73.3%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 58.3%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 110.1 degrees, a saturation of 44.5% and a lightness of 52%. #60bb4e color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ff9c with #007700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#60bb4e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#60bb4e has RGB values of R:96, G:187, B:78 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0, Y:0.58,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 6339406.
